Teaching process:
First, contact with real life to stimulate interest
1. Ask the students to recall whether they have worn or intend to throw away socks in their drawers, and tell them why they don't want to wear them again.
2. Show two cartoon socks made of cardboard and stick them on the blackboard. Who wants to take care of them? Encourage students to actively find ways to get socks to find a "job" again.
Second, encourage students to express creatively
1. Communicate your ideas in groups or with your children, and students can make suggestions to each other.
2. Communicate with the whole class and guide the students to make their ideas clear.
Encourage students to express themselves better by drawing pictures and communicating with others according to their own needs.
Third, select the "golden idea" award.
Comprehensive learning
Teaching requirements:
1, encourage students to actively participate in expressing their opinions.
2. Cultivate students' comprehensive ability to use Chinese knowledge.
Teaching focus:
Encourage students to actively participate and express their opinions.
Teaching difficulties:
Cultivate students' comprehensive ability to use Chinese knowledge.
Class schedule: 1 class hour
Teaching activity design:
First, import
1, students, this semester's study is coming to an end. Can you tell us what you have learned from this book?
2. Students can speak freely.
3. Teacher section: The learning content of our book is rich! There are literacy classes, ancient poems, texts and Chinese paradise. ...
Second, communication.
1, group communication, what do you like and dislike in this book?
2. Communicate with the whole class.
Do you want to tell your uncles and aunts in the editorial department what you think? Then how can I contact them? Name, department.
If you want to contact them, you must first know the telephone number or mailing address there, or email address, which are hidden in our text. Go and find it!
5. Students have free activities.
6. Say by name, randomly show an enlarged picture of Chinese description, and outline the address and telephone number.
Third, homework after class.
Go online, call or write to tell the uncles and aunts in the editorial department whether you like or dislike the contents of the book.
